Influence of Biochar on Physico-Chemical, Microbial Community and Maturity during Biogas Residue Aerobic Composting Process

Abstract

With the rapid development of large and medium-sized biogas projects, the high-value utilization of anaerobic fermentation residues has become a hot spot in recent years. In this study, biogas residue from biogas engineering was used as composting raw material, and 0 (CK), 2.5% (T1), 5.0% (T2), 7.5% (T3), and 10.0% (T4) biochar was added to investigate its effects on physico-chemical properties, microbial populations, and maturity degree during the aerobic composting process. Results show that the addition of biochar shortens the time (3 days) to reach the high-temperature period, increases the composting temperature (63.8 °C) and germination index (GI), decreases the electrical conductivity (EC), reduces the loss of C and N elements, and increases the microbial population during composting. These results suggest that biochar can improve the maturity and fertility of compost products, and significantly regulate the structure and function of microbial communities during the composting process.
